    Who is Dr. Jones, Pediatric Radiologist in Cincinnati, OH?

    Dr. Blaise Jones, MD is a Pediatric Radiologist, who primarily practices in Cincinnati, OH with 2 additional practice locations. He is board certified by the American Board of Radiology. Dr. Jones graduated from Georgetown University School of Medicine and completed his residency at Childrens Hosp Med Ctr, Pediatric Radiology; University Hosp, Inc, Diagnostic Radiology. Dr. Jones is fluent in English,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Jones’s practice accepts Medicare, UnitedHealthcare, Cigna and other major insurance plans.     What is Dr. Blaise Jones's specialty?

    Dr. Jones is a Pediatric Radiologist near Cincinnati, OH. A pediatric radiologist specializes in all forms of diagnostic imaging related to the treatment of diseases in newborns, infants, children, and adolescents. This specialist possesses expertise in both imaging and interventional procedures for managing pediatric diseases. They must have a high knowledge and thorough understanding of organ systems as they relate to growth and development, congenital malformations, diseases specific to children, and conditions that begin in childhood and lead to significant impairment in adulthood.
